The Lazy River

A couple weeks ago I heard about a local water park with a lazy river and ever since visiting Sea World's Discovery Cove, I do love a lazy river. Anyway, my friend said that this water park opens the lazy river early 3 days a week for people who want to walk the lazy river....either with the current or against the current.

Lori and I decided to give it a go this morning and oh my goodness is that a good workout!

We manager to complete about 6.5 trips around. That equals a little over 1 mile walking against the current. Wow! My legs were really burning by about halfway around the FIRST lap, by the third lap I could feel blisters brewing on the ball of my left foot and by the time we hit the last lap I felt a blister brewing on the ball of my right foot.

When the time had elapsed and we were all asked to exit the water I was just arriving at a zero entry ramp where I could simply walk up the ramp to exit the river. Yes, I know that sounds very benign but after pushing against the current for a mile or so, walking up that ramp and losing the buoyancy of the water was way more difficult than it sounds. My legs felt so wobbly and couldn't stop giggling. I think that was my first experience with what my body will feel like when exiting the water at the triathlon. I'll have to give that some practice over the next year.

All in all that was a great way to start a Saturday
